Summary:The invention discloses a VPP demand response resource aggregation optimization method based on load directrix excitation, and relates to the field of VPP aggregation demand response resources of a virtual power plant, and the method comprises the steps: setting a demand response market behavior framework based on CDL excitation; establishing a day-ahead and intra-day two-stage scheduling optimization model of the VPP aggregation demand response resources; and establishing a fair and reasonable income distribution and risk sharing mechanism for the two-stage scheduling optimization model of the VPP.
